- Statement
- The method followed that of Möller (2006). Side-on photography was undertaken in the field using a frame to ensure consistent geometry and a calibrated Fuji Finepix XP30 camera. Photographs were rectified using Matlab and exported in TIFF format to Erdas Imagine for classification. A 20-class unsupervised classification was performed followed by manual attribution of classes into "background" and vegetation". The binary image files were then analysed in Matlab based on pixel sizes derived from the camera calibration procedure against a chequerboard background. Further methodological details are contained in the supporting document.
